Kentucky Links/Injuries

ed. - bumped from the fanposts.

I am excited for the upcoming game against UK, and it looks like they have some problems to overcome. 

Kentucky's best defensive player, Micah Johnson, is likely out for the game.  Johnson.  He was preseason third team All-SEC selection at linebacker, and was one of the most highly sought after recruits in UK history.  This does not bode well for their run defense, as he was a really good run defender.

Also, right tackle Justin Jefferies is out for the game.  He has 17 career starts. 

Then of course you have starting safety for Kentucky.  He was arrested on Friday.

He is charged with second-degree stalking, third-degree terroristic threatening, and harassing communications.

 Not sure if he plays or not, but that too does not bode well for the Wildcats.  He did not play against WKU. 

There was a great quote from WKU running back, Bobby Rainey comparing the two teams.

"To me, they don't match up," Rainey said. "Alabama is bigger and faster. As far as Kentucky, to me, they're softer up front."

Most people thought that Kentucky would have a good defense, and they seemingly do at this point.  In fairness their toughest opponent would seem to be Louisville, who still looks like a train wreck since Petrino left, so not sure how much you can gleam from this game. 

I will guarantee that you will constantly hear about how Kentucky beat LSU last year around this same time (October 13, 2007).  Over/under 4.5 times that Saban mentions this during his press confrences this week.  It will be interesting to hear how Saban thinks practices are going in his mid-week press confrence.  He will usually provide a lot of information, and let people know how his team is practicing.
